    Siemens Smart Infrastructure gets Apeksha Jain as head-HR

    Siemens Smart Infrastructure has appointed Apeksha Jain as its new head-human resources. Jain brings over 15 years of expertise in the realms of food and beverages, manufacturing, and telecommunications to her new role.

    Prior to this, Jain was associated with Godrej Chemicals as its head-HR since 2019. During her tenure, she successfully led people and culture initiatives for the past five years before concluding her responsibilities earlier this month.

    Furthermore, her professional journey includes diverse roles at PepsiCo, Vodafone, Hindustan Unilever (HUL), Virgin Mobile, and Impetus Technologies.

    Jain started her career with Impetus Technologies, a software company, where she joined as a summer intern in the year 2008, for four months. Then she moved to Virgin Mobile as a trainee for a year.

    In 2010, she joined Vodafone as its area sales manager, followed by a short stint at Unilever as a PepsiCo Extern in its JV with PepsiCo, in the year 2017, for three months. This gave her enhanced exposure and learning opportunities.

    Her longest stint was with PepsiCo where she contributed to talent acquisition, campus leadership, served as a senior HR business partner, talent acquisition and campus lead-India, and held the position of plant HR head. She joined the company in 2011-2019.

    Jain’s key strengths encompass cultural transformation, talent strategy, organisational design, strategic human resources leadership, workforce planning, compensation and benefits, as well as social influence.

    On the academic front, Jain holds a bachelor’s degree in engineering (computer science) , from Rajiv Gandhi Prodyogiki Vishwavidyalaya, and an MBA degree in human resources from ICFAI Business School.

    She also did a I LEAP programme in general management from IIM Ahmedabad, and a young leaders programme in strategic HR leadership and general management from XLRI Jamshedpur.
